Canadian University Dubai Hosts Driven | Forbes Global Properties for Real Estate Career Awareness Coffee Chat

November 11, 2025, Dubai, United Arab Emirates (UAE): Canadian University Dubai (CUD) successfully concluded a highly insightful Real Estate Career Awareness and Recruitment Coffee Chat in partnership with Driven | Forbes Global Properties, one of the UAE’s leading real estate brokerages. The event, hosted by the CUD Career Services and Internship Office, provided Management students with essential industry knowledge and career-focused dialogue as part of CUD's commitment to industry engagement and professional development.

Coffee Chat Highlights and Industry Insights

The coffee chat offered students a comprehensive look at the lucrative and dynamic Dubai real estate sector. Key topics covered included:

  • Market Opportunity: The session emphasized the advantages of joining the industry, highlighting the potential for high earnings, tax-free income, and career growth within a booming market. Participants also learned about the global exposure and the safe, stable investment environment that the UAE provides.
  • The Agent's Role: Students received an insider's perspective on "A Day in an Agent's Life", detailing the core responsibilities of a property consultant and the key professional traits required for success, such as proactive communication, time management, persistence, and relationship building.
  • Consumer Behaviour: A significant portion of the seminar focused on "Understanding Consumer Behaviour in Real Estate". The discussion centred on how consultants can effectively leverage buyer motivations, market segmentation, and adaptive communication styles to drive successful results.
